探索Julia Rendering:渲染技术的未来之星

探索Julia Rendering:渲染技术的未来之星

JuliaRendering项目地址:https://gitcode.com/gh_mirrors/ju/JuliaRendering


在数字时代的洪流中,高质量的视觉效果已成为各类应用不可或缺的一部分。今天,我们要带您深入了解一个令人振奋的开源项目——Julia Rendering,这不仅是一个技术上的突破,更是创意与科技相融合的璀璨明珠。

项目介绍

Julia Rendering 是一款专为高效、高质量图形渲染而生的开源工具。它基于Julia编程语言,旨在简化复杂渲染流程,使得无论是专业开发者还是业余爱好者,都能轻松创建出令人惊叹的视觉作品。项目通过集成先进的算法和优化的性能,打破了传统渲染软件的边界,开启了高性能渲染的新篇章。

项目技术分析

Julia Rendering 深度利用了Julia语言的速度优势和简洁语法,实现了快速迭代开发的同时保持代码的可读性和维护性。其核心技术亮点包括:

  • 并行计算的强大支持:借助Julia内置的并行处理能力,Julia Rendering能够高效地分配任务到多核处理器,大大提升渲染速度。
  • 高级光照模型:集成了多种高级光照算法,如路径追踪、全局照明,为场景带来逼真的光影效果。
  • 自适应采样技术:自动调整采样密度以减少噪点,提供更加平滑的图像质量,无需漫长的试错过程。
  • 材质系统灵活多样:支持广泛的材质定义,让艺术家的创造力得以最大限度发挥。

项目及技术应用场景

从电影特效、游戏开发到科学可视化和建筑设计,Julia Rendering的应用潜力无限广阔:

  • 影视制作:为动画短片或特效镜头提供高效且细腻的渲染解决方案,加速后期制作流程。
  • 虚拟现实/增强现实:高效率渲染动态环境,提高用户体验的真实感和沉浸感。
  • 科研教育:在模拟实验和数据可视化中,以直观的形式展示复杂的科学概念。
  • 建筑设计:帮助建筑师快速预览设计效果,进行真实感渲染,助力决策和客户沟通。

项目特点

  • 学习曲线友好:即使是Julia语言的新手也能快速上手,得益于其清晰的文档和社区支持。
  • 高度可扩展性:项目架构鼓励模块化和插件化,允许开发者根据需求定制功能。
  • 跨平台兼容:无论是在Windows、macOS还是Linux下,都能流畅运行,确保了广泛的应用基础。
  • 持续进化:活跃的社区保证了项目不断吸收最新的研究进展,保持技术的前沿性。

总结,Julia Rendering 不仅仅是一个工具,它是通往视觉艺术新境界的钥匙。对于追求卓越视觉体验的创作者而言,这是一次不容错过的技术探索之旅。加入这个充满活力的社区,一起开启高效、美观、创新的渲染新时代吧!


以上就是对Julia Rendering项目的一个概览,希望能激发您的兴趣,不论是深度学习还是简单尝试,相信它都能成为你创作道路上的得力助手。让我们在技术的海洋里,共同寻找那份独属于创造者的喜悦。

JuliaRendering项目地址:https://gitcode.com/gh_mirrors/ju/JuliaRendering

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

谭思麟

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值